Joining the Quavblok network

Quavblok is a multi-game Minecraft: Java Edition network at mc.quavern.net; it is not an official Minecraft service and is not associated with Mojang or Microsoft.

Add mc.quavern.net in the multiplayer menu and join. Small rotating rounds: duels, parkour, build challenges.

Quavblok runs on Minecraft: Java Edition. Playing needs a Minecraft: Java Edition account, and Mojang's and Microsoft's terms apply to that account and to the game.

Not an official Minecraft service

Quavblok is not an official Minecraft service, and is not approved by or associated with Mojang or Microsoft. It is a network run by Quavern.

You do not have to link an account

Linking your Minecraft account to myQuavern is optional. Join and play without it. Linking is what gives you your player settings and /marl in the game chat — see "Linking your Minecraft account".

Moving between worlds

The network holds a lobby, a games backend and a survival world. Walk through a gate zone in the lobby, or use the server switch command, to move between them.

What it costs

Nothing. There is no store, no season pass and no pressure to stay. Join for a round, leave when you like.

If you cannot connect

Check status.quavern.net first: the game server is probed there, and declared maintenance appears there too. If the status page is green, write to [email protected] with your Minecraft name, your client version, the time you tried, and the exact message the client showed.
